Rules of Play and Game Roles
The key play math is:
Total Play = Bonus Amount × Times
For example, a 30x play rule on a $100 bonus means $3,000 in bets needed before you can take money out. Game Variations: Exploring
Casinos change how games count:
- Slot Games: 100% count
- Table Games: 10-50% count
- Blackjack: 10% count
